Quentin Tarantino begs Cannes audiences not to spoil 'Once Upon a Time in Hollywood'


Quentin Tarantino wants Tuesday’s Cannes Film Festival premiere of “Once Upon a Time in Hollywood” to be a spoiler-free zone. It’s unclear if Tarantino (who offed Hitler in “Inglourious Basterds” in a machine gun frenzy) will deviate from history as he grapples with the infamous Manson murders. Leonardo DiCaprio and Brad Pitt play a movie star and his stunt double, while Margot Robbie plays Sharon Tate.
